Introduction to Wild Orange Essential Oil
Wild orange essential oil is extracted from the peel of the Citrus sinensis fruit through a process of cold pressing. This method helps preserve the oil’s natural chemical composition, which includes a high concentration of limonene, a compound known for its therapeutic properties. The oil’s distinct orange color and uplifting scent are immediately recognizable, making it a favorite among aromatherapists and those who appreciate the emotional and physical benefits it offers.
Chemical Composition and Therapeutic Properties
The chemical composition of wild orange essential oil is what sets it apart from other essential oils, particularly in terms of its therapeutic applications. The oil is primarily composed of limonene, which accounts for approximately 90% of its chemical makeup. Limonene is known for its antimicrobial, anti-inflammatory, and antioxidant properties, making wild orange essential oil a valuable tool in various health and wellness practices.

Applications and Precautions
When using wild orange essential oil, it’s essential to follow proper guidelines to ensure safety and effectiveness. The oil can be used topically, in aromatherapy, or internally, but dilution with a carrier oil and consultation with a healthcare professional are recommended.
Precautions and Contraindications
- Skin Sensitivity: Wild orange essential oil can cause skin sensitivity in some individuals, so a patch test is advised before using it topically.
- Pregnancy and Breastfeeding: Women who are pregnant or breastfeeding should use the oil with caution and under the guidance of a healthcare provider.
- Phototoxicity: The oil can cause phototoxicity, so it’s crucial to avoid direct sunlight after applying it to the skin.

How do I store Wild Orange Essential Oil?
Storing Wild Orange Essential Oil correctly is essential to maintain its quality and potency. The oil should be stored in a cool, dark place, away from direct sunlight and heat sources. The ideal storage temperature is between 60°F and 80°F (15°C and 27°C), and the oil should be kept away from moisture and humidity. It’s also essential to store the oil in a tightly sealed container, such as a glass bottle with a screw-top lid, to prevent oxidation and contamination. Additionally, always check the oil’s label for any specific storage instructions, as some oils may require special handling and storage.
When storing Wild Orange Essential Oil, it’s also essential to consider its shelf life and expiration date. The oil’s shelf life can vary depending on its quality, storage conditions, and handling. Generally, high-quality Wild Orange Essential Oil can last for up to two years when stored correctly. However, it’s essential to regularly check the oil’s quality and potency, as it can degrade over time. If the oil becomes cloudy, discolored, or develops an off smell, it’s best to discard it and purchase a fresh batch.
